Indian television dramas, often called Indian series or serials, are scripted television programs made in India, featuring Indian actors. These dramas are broadcast on Indian television networks. India's first television drama, '' Hum Log'' ( Hindi), aired from 1984 to 1985 and had 154 episodes. Ekta Kapoor's '' Kyunki Saas Bhi Kabhi Bahu Thi'' (2000–2008) became the first Indian TV drama to surpass 1,000 episodes, with a total of 1,833 episodes, entering the Limca Book of Records. The Marathi series '' Char Divas Sasuche'' (2001–2013) reached 3,200 episodes, becoming the first Indian series to exceed 3,000 episodes, also entering the Limca Book of Records. The Telugu series '' Abhishekam'' (2008–2022) was the first Indian show to reach 4,000 episodes, ending on 1 February 2022. Disney+ Hotstar, also known as JioHotstar or simply Hotstar, is an Indian subscription video-on-demand over-the-top streaming service owned by Disney Star. The brand was introduced as Hotstar for a streaming service carrying content from Disney Star's (formerly Star India) local networks, including films, television series, live sports, and original programming, as well as featuring content licensed from third parties such as Showtime among others. Amid the significant growth of mobile broadband in India, Hotstar quickly became the dominant streaming service in the country. Following the acquisition of Star India's parent company 21st Century Fox by Disney in 2019, Hotstar was integrated into Disney's global streaming brand Disney+ as 'Disney+ Hotstar' in April 2020. Renuka Shahane (born 7 October 1966) is an Indian actress who is widely known for her work in the Hindi and Marathi films and several television productions. She is best known as the co-presenter of the Doordarshan TV show '' Surabhi'' (1993–2001). She has received several awards and nominations including a Filmfare Award Marathi. Early life Renuka Shahane was born into a Marathi family in Mumbai. Her father, Lt. Cdr. Vijay Kumar Shahane, was an officer in the Indian Navy. Her mother, Shanta Gokhale, is a theatre personality and film critic who works mainly on Marathi theatre. When Renuka was very young, her mother divorced her father and married Arun Khopkar, a film-maker. The second marriage also ended in divorce. Renuka and her only sibling, Girish Shahane grew up with their mother in Mumbai. Imran Zahid (born 11 January 1982) is an Indian actor in both theatre and Bollywood. He has acted in Mahesh Bhatt's ''The Last Salute'', based on Muntadhar al-Zaidi's book of the same title and the stageplay ''The Arth'', based on Bhatt's movie '' Arth''. His latest play was ''Daddy'' based on Bhatt's movie of the same name. Early life Imran Zahid was born as in Bokaro Steel City, Bokaro, Jharkhand He began acting while at DAV Public School, Sector IV in Bokaro Steel City. He then attended Hindu College, Delhi University, from where he got a B.Com degree. Acting While at university Zahid became involved with a theatre group run by Arvind Gaur. He continued acting while being employed as a professor. Zahid has said that he had neither the desire nor the need to work in Mumbai.
